A Books4Me Snow Day

Ready for a snow day?

Ok, we rarely take snow days here in Regina, being hardy prairie folk. But winter is here, so it’s a good time to talk about being prepared for the unexpected. 

Hopefully we’ve all got our home and car emergency kits stocked with everything we’ll need to handle a flat tire, power outage, or holiday zombie apocalypse (shoutout to my fellow Christopher Moore fans). 

But are you ready for an entertainment emergency?!

We love a good binge-watch as much as the next person, but if the power goes out for more than an hour, or you’re concerned about your kids having too much screen time during a classroom close-contact isolation period, you might want to have some non-digital options on hand. Our favourite? Books (obviously)!

Our Books4Me service is a great way to start building your entertainment emergency kit. 

Fill out our online form to get a personalized list of reading recommendations based on your interests. Then enter the titles from your Books4Me list into our catalogue to borrow them from the library – or use it as your shopping or wish list.

And just like that, you’ve got three weeks worth of reading material on standby!

Or if you’re extra nerdy like me, you can pair your Books4Me titles with other items you have on hand – choose recipe books themed to match whatever’s currently lingering in your freezer; pair knitting magazines with your yarn stash; or break out the art supplies and take inspiration from DIY crafting books. The possibilities are basically endless.
